And before getting, discover regarding the state regulations around home window tinting so you can make a notified decision.State laws manage the degree of darkness permitted for auto glass tinting. Window tint legislations are created as a safety and security problem for vehicle drivers to see other cars much better when driving, and for regulation enforcement policemans as they come close to an auto. When determining just how much to tint windows, you have to inspect your state's Department of Electric motor Automobiles to learn more about the policies, consisting of the legal noticeable light transmission (VLT) levels.
State laws specify the level of color allowed for each home window of guest lorries - Window Tinting. All states have constraints on tinting put on front windshields. A lot of states limit the amount of tint on a cars and truck's windshield or front side home windows. 7 states (Alaska, California, Delaware, Iowa, New York,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island) and the District of Columbia require 70% light transmission on colored home windows.

State legislations may change annual. Reliable window tinting companies hired to set up aftermarket color movie will certainly recognize with the regulations in your location. Nonetheless, your conformity with the legislation for vehicle home window tinting could change if you relocate to another state. Many states supply car home window tinting exemptions for motorists with a legitimate medical or vision-related demand to restrict their direct exposure to sunshine.

Normally, motorists with sunlight level of sensitivity might make an application for a license, waiver, or exemption from the state's tinting law via the Department of Electric Motor Automobiles. The motorist has to send the application with documents sustaining the clinical requirement for tinted home windows. Fines vary for breaching a state's laws on tinted vehicle home windows.

There isn't an easy response since several variables will certainly influence auto window tinting prices. The top quality and type of color you want to install. In very general terms, and depending on the top quality and functions of the material used, vehicle home window tinting costs for a car can be $250 to $500.
Don't assume that a greater price suggests far better quality. Browse through shops in individual to get quotes. Check out the sanitation of the workspace, look into the tasks they're working with, and request for references. A respectable color shop will gladly show you its work and have previous consumers share their experiences.
You can acquire cars and truck home window tint film by the roll. Some manufacturers offer DIY home window tint packages that come pre-cut for certain lorry versions. The installment technique is straightforward, but the job requires a significant amount of perseverance, careful interest to detail, and a level of ability that follows lots of practice.
Any type of item assurances could need setup by shops or specialists licensed by the tint producer. Be sure to complete the color service warranty paperwork after installation and maintain all invoices and information from the shop.
